Plugin Minecraft BlueSlimeCore

Informazioni su BlueSlimeCore e i server dove e stato trovato

🔌 Informazioni su BlueSlimeCore

BlueSlimeCore è un plugin Minecraft in stile libreria, pensato come base condivisa per altri plugin. Riunisce comandi di utilità lato server e una API per sviluppatori che semplifica attività comuni (configurazione, lingue/messaggi, menu, builder di oggetti, gestione delle versioni) così gli autori possono riutilizzare funzionalità in più plugin.

🎯 Scopo

Il plugin risolve la duplicazione dell'infrastruttura comune dei plugin: केंदralizza la gestione della configurazione, la gestione delle lingue, la creazione dei menu, gli helper di compatibilità multiversione e un piccolo set di comandi di utilità amministrativi, così i plugin dipendenti possono concentrarsi sulle funzionalità invece che sul codice ripetitivo.

⚙️ Funzionalità

  • API per sviluppatori per la gestione della configurazione e delle lingue (supporto lingua per giocatore, MiniMessage, PlaceholderAPI).
  • API per i menu per creare inventory, pulsanti e menu a pagine.
  • Utility per la creazione di oggetti per item, armature di pelle, pozioni e teste dei giocatori.
  • Helper multiversione/NMS per spawn di entità, health/absorption, pacchetti di cooldown e controlli TPS.
  • API del gestore Factions per aiutare la compatibilità con più implementazioni di Factions.
  • Controllo aggiornamenti del plugin per SpigotMC o Hangar.
  • Piccoli comandi di utilità del server per ispezionare oggetti e fare debug dei listener degli eventi.

🧩 A chi è rivolto

  • Sviluppatori di plugin che vogliono una base riutilizzabile per funzionalità comuni del server.
  • Amministratori di server che eseguono più plugin SirBlobman o altri plugin che dipendono dalle utility di BlueSlimeCore.

🏗️ Esempi d'uso

  • Uno sviluppatore usa l'API dei menu per costruire un'interfaccia negozio senza scrivere da zero la gestione dell'inventario.
  • Un admin usa item-to-nbt per controllare i dati NBT di un oggetto durante il debug.
  • Un plugin integra il gestore factions per supportare più implementazioni di Factions con un unico livello di integrazione.

⌨️ Comandi

ComandoDescrizionePermessoAccesso
/item-to-nbtVisualizza i tag dei dati NBT sull'oggetto in mano.non specificatoAdmin
/item-to-base64Converte l'oggetto in mano in una stringa Base64.non specificatoAdmin
/debug-eventTrova quali plugin e listener sono registrati per un evento specifico.non specificatoAdmin

⚙️ Installazione

📥 Configurazione

  • Scarica il jar ufficiale di BlueSlimeCore e inseriscilo nella directory plugins/ del tuo server.
  • Assicurati che il server esegua una build supportata di Spigot/Paper/Folia e avvia o riavvia il server.
  • Verifica che il plugin sia stato caricato controllando la console del server per i messaggi di avvio di BlueSlimeCore.

📦 Dipendenze

  • Richiede Java 25 (requisito JVM del server confermato dal repository del progetto).

🧠 Note tecniche

  • Software server supportato confermato: Spigot, Paper, Folia.
  • Il progetto espone API pensate per altri sviluppatori di plugin; installa il jar di BlueSlimeCore su qualsiasi server che esegua plugin che dipendono da esso.
  • Il repository è con licenza GPL-3.0.

🤝 Quando questo plugin è utile

Se gestisci più plugin o sviluppi funzionalità che si basano su utility comuni del server (menu, messaggi, supporto multiversione), BlueSlimeCore riduce il codice duplicato e fornisce una superficie API coerente per amministratori e manutentori di plugin.

Server con il plugin BlueSlimeCore

La pagina del plugin BlueSlimeCore mostra su quali server il monitoraggio ha trovato questo plugin, con quali piattaforme e versioni compare.

I plugin possono aggiungere comandi, economia, protezione, diritti di accesso, minigiochi, integrazioni o altre meccaniche. Il ruolo effettivo di BlueSlimeCore dipende dalla configurazione del singolo server.

I dati vengono generati automaticamente dalle risposte tecniche dei server. Se un server nasconde l'elenco dei plugin, potrebbe non comparire in questa sezione anche se usa BlueSlimeCore.

Usa l'elenco dei server con BlueSlimeCore per confrontare i progetti, verificare le versioni compatibili o trovare esempi di utilizzo del plugin su server pubblici.